As verbs, nuzzle is a hyponym of cling to; that is, nuzzle is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than cling to:
  • cling to: hold firmly, usually with one's hands
  • nuzzle: move or arrange oneself in a comfortable and cozy position
Other hyponyms of cling to include cuddle, draw close, nest, nestle, snuggle.
